Big Brothers Big Sisters serves young people from age six through fourteen in one-to-one mentoring friendships. Bigs and Littles hang out 2-3 times a month for a few hours doing normal, everyday activities, like seeing a movie, doing homework, playing games, going out to eat, or just hanging out!
Each match is supported by a dedicated Match Support Specialist who is always there to provide resources and support specific to the Little’s age. With a Big in their life, Littles in the Big Brothers Big Sisters program are empowered to ignite their potential as they grow in their self-esteem, earn better grades, and develop a lifelong friendship with their Big.

Male Mentors Needed

More than 70% of our children waiting for a Big are boys, but only three out of every 10 inquiries to volunteer come from men.  Research shows that having the positive influence of a Big Brother makes a real difference in the life of a boy.

Eligibility Requirements to be a Big:
  • Must be at least 18 years old.
  • Must be able to make a minimum 12 month commitment. For students this is a 3 contiguous semester time commitment.
  • Must be able to meet with your Little for a total of 8 hours a month (usually 2 hours a week).
  • Never have been charged or convicted of a sex crime, child abuse, child neglect or molestation.
  • Meet specific criminal history guidelines.
  • Must attend a Pre-Match Training before being matched.
  • Must be excited to be a fun and positive role model!
Role of a Big:
  • Emphasize friendship over changing the behavior of the child.
  • Be consistent and dependable.
  • Be patient.
  • Focus on fun.
  • Acknowledge that positive impact on the child comes after the relationship is built.
  • Have realistic expectations.
  • Put the child's safety and well being first.
  • Set a good example for your Little.
  • Share your strengths and recognize your imperfections...Bigs are not meant to be perfect.
